Defence Instruction (General) Personnel 16-1, Health Care to Australian Defence Force Personnel defines the health care entitlements of serving personnel. Health care, in this context, encompasses a spectrum of services that extends from emergency care through to the provision of rehabilitation.

Members eligible for ADFRP

A member must be eligible for health care to be eligible for the ADF Rehabilitation Program (ADFRP). In addition, personnel must satisfy the eligibility criteria for rehabilitation as detailed in Annex A of Defence Instruction (General) Personnel 16-22, Australian Defence Force rehabilitation program.

Members not eligible for ADFRP

The management of personnel not eligible for ADFRP is detailed in Annex A of Defence Instruction (General) Personnel 16-22, Australian Defence Force rehabilitation program.

The Internet Icon Military Rehabilitation and Compensation Scheme (MRCS) provides rehabilitation, treatment and compensation for ADF members who suffer mental or physical injury or contract a disease as a result of service on or after 1 July 2004. It also provides compensation to their eligible dependants if their death is related to service on or after 1 July 2004, if they were entitled to maximum permanent impairment compensation, or, had been eligible for a Special Rate Disability Pension.
